CABADING v. PORT OF PORTLAND

No. 3:20-cv-00312-HZ.

JONATHAN CABADING, an individual, Plaintiff, v. PORT OF PORTLAND, an Oregon municipal corporation and port district of the State of Oregon, in personam, KINDER MORGAN OPERATING L.P. "C", a Texas limited partnership, in personam, and KINDER MORGAN BULK TERMINALS, LLC, a Texas limited liability company, in personam, Defendants.

United States District Court, D. Oregon.

April 4, 2022.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Gordon T. Carey, Jr. , Portland, OR, Nicholas J. Neidzwski , Anderson Carey Williams Neidzwski, Bellingham, WA, Attorneys for Plaintiff.

Chris M. Reilly , W.L. Rivers Black, III , Nicoll Black & Feig, PLLC, Seattle, WA, Attorneys for Defendant Port of Portland.

Paul A.C. Berg , Chester D. Hill , Cosgrave Vergeer Kester, LLP, Portland, OR, Attorneys for Defendant Kinder Morgan.


OPINION & ORDER

Plaintiff Johnathan Cabading was severely injured when he was struck by a mooring line while onboard a vessel docked at Berth 410/411 at the Port of Portland's Terminal Four. Plaintiff brings negligence claims against Defendant Port of Portland and Defendants Kinder Morgan Operating...
